2. Taxi
Taxis are readily available in Taksim. You can easily hail one on the street or use a ride-hailing app like BiTaksi or Uber. While more affordable than a private transfer, taxi fares can still be relatively high, particularly during peak hours or due to traffic congestion. Remember to confirm the meter is running and the route is efficient to avoid overcharges.
- Accessibility: Easily available.
- Flexibility: Direct to the airport, no transfers.
- Potentially higher cost than public transport: Be mindful of traffic and meter accuracy.
3. Havabus Shuttle
The Havabus is a cost-effective shuttle bus service connecting various points in Istanbul to Sabiha Gökçen Airport. While it's not a direct door-to-door service, it’s a convenient and affordable option. You would need to take a taxi or other transport from Taksim Elegance Suites to a Havabus pick-up point. This adds time and complexity to the journey, though the bus ride itself is relatively quick and comfortable.
- Affordability: Significantly cheaper than a taxi or private transfer.
- Regular schedule: Buses run frequently.
- Requires additional travel to a pick-up point: Adds time to your overall travel time.
